Direction: Study the following information carefully to answer the given questions:
There are ten persons i.e. A, B, C, D, E, P, Q, R, S and T who lives in a building having Six floors such that ground floor is numbered as 1 and above it is 2 and so on up to top floor numbered as 6. Each of the floor consist of 2 flats as flat-1, flat-2. Flat-1 of floor-2 is immediately above flat-1 of floor-1 and immediately below flat-1 of floor-3 and in the same way flat-2 of floor-2 is immediately above flat-2 of floor-1 and immediately below flat-2 of floor-3 and so on. Flat-2 is in east of Flat-1. Two flats are vacant but they are not adjacent. If A lives above (or below) B, then there are living in same flat unless stated otherwise. Only two persons live below E who lives immediately below of S, who lives in Flat-2. D lives towards South-East of R who lives to the immediate south of P and share the same flat as of P. B and P shared the same floor which is an even numbered such that B lives east of P. No flat in ground floor is Vacant. A’s floor number is twice of the floor number of C, both are living in even numbered floor. There is only one person lives on the floor in which R lives. A lives north-west of either T or Q. Neither T nor Q lives west of S.
